Proposed revision to the estimation of fisheries footprints
Abstract: A revised approach to the estimation of longline fisheries footprints is presented. The ... method uses a data-derived estimate of the uncertainty around the locations of longlines to define a ... grid. The proportion of the area of each grid cell that is covered by buffered lines is then used as a ... footprint index. Changes in biomass of eight species of finfish around the South Orkney Islands (Subarea 48.2) from three bottom trawl surveys
Abstract: Stocks of finfish around the South Orkney Islands (Subarea 48.2) suffered substantial ... declines during the period the fishery was open from split year 1977/78 through 1989/90. Scientific bottom ... trawl surveys of finfish biomass within the 500 m isobath of the South Orkney Islands have been ... conducted by the Federal Republic of Germany in 1985, Spain in 1991, and the United States in 1999 ...
